The six-issue limited series comes to a head with this finale, its cover by Carlo Pagulayan and Jason Paz putting a battle-worn soldier front and center — bloodied, gripping a pistol in one hand and a knife in the other, advancing through a firestorm with quiet, iron-willed determination. Marvel's banner promise that "the future of the Marvel Universe begins here" gives the image real weight, suggesting everything this series has built is about to pay off. Chris Yost, Scot Eaton, Andrew Hennessy, and Paul Mounts bring this soldier's journey to its conclusion, and the cover alone makes clear he's earned every scar.
